“We’re always attuned to any scraps of information we get about how we’re viewed by other people,” she says, but rarely do we receive any. According to Bohns’ research, people feel “significantly better” after both giving and receiving a compliment, compared to how they felt beforehand. When it comes to keeping your cannabis stash mold-free, how you store and handle your weed is just as important as where you get it. Mold growth thrives in environments with excess moisture, fluctuating temperatures, and poor airflow—conditions that can easily develop if you’re not careful with your storage methods. For anyone, but especially those with weakened immune systems, consuming moldy weed can pose significant health risks, ranging from mild allergic reactions to serious lung infections. Accepting compliments isn’t just about boosting your ego; it’s about fostering connection (Fredrickson, 2009). Compliments are small acts of kindness that say, “I see you. I value you.” By brushing them off, we unintentionally dismiss the giver’s thoughtfulness and vulnerability. Moreover, learning to accept praise can help us rewrite those internal scripts of self-doubt. When we practice embracing positive feedback, we affirm not only our worth but also the relationships that give life its richness.
